BODY OVERVIEW:
This 1966 Mustang convertible captures the essence of vintage American style. Its iconic lines and trim are well-preserved, and the car is straight and solid overall. This car presents nicely both on top and underneath, and should satisfy any Mustang enthusiast seeking an affordable early convertible.
PAINT CONDITION OVERVIEW:
The Silver Blue Poly paint has a charming shine that looks fantastic cruising in the sunlight. The driver's side fender has been repainted, and while the color match isn’t perfect, it blends well enough for a nice driver-quality car. While the repaint on the fender is noticeable, the rest of the car wears its paint beautifully, making it a real head-turner. This car is perfect for those who appreciate a great-looking classic without obsessing over perfection!
INTERIOR CONDITION OVERVIEW:
The blue vinyl interior is believed to be largely original, showcasing that classic mid-1960s Mustang style. It’s in great condition for its age, with minor age that gives it a touch of vintage authenticity achieved only by the passage of time. The seats are comfortable, and the buttons and trim have aged nicely. This is a comfortable classic cruiser!
MECHANICAL OVERVIEW:
Under the hood is the trusty Ford 200ci inline 6-cylinder engine, offering smooth, quiet performance ideal for cruising. The automatic transmission shifts confidently, and the power steering and power drum brakes make this Mustang easy to handle.
